Transaction 907538add818c1ac9477cd94f101e59af747077a161f652adaf1be3fb7beb585
1 Input
1 Output
-
907538add818c1ac9477cd94f101e59af747077a161f652adaf1be3fb7beb585:0
- value
- 5539
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 6388769a05abd3c2adae2a73bd6e270801aeaab93f6dec2177cd96a518dee522
- address
- bc1pvwy8dxs940fu9tdw9fem6m38pqq6a24e8ak7cgthekt22xx7u53qx7lec3